Inspection Procedure

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2008 Lexus LS 600hL.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
NOTE: When using the Intelligent tester or Techstream with the power switch OFF to troubleshoot: Connect the Intelligent tester or Techstream to the vehicle, and turn a courtesy switch on and off at 1.5 second intervals until communication between the tester and vehicle begins.
  1. C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(REAR JUNCTION BLOCK ECU - MAP LIGHT) 
    Fig 1: Identifying Rear Junction Block ECU Connector S62 & Map Light Connector X6
    G04946988Courtesy of © TOYOTA, LICENSE AGREEMENT TMS1002
    1. Disconnect the S62 ECU connector
    2. Disconnect the X6 Map light connector
    3. Measure the resistance and voltage according to the value(s) in the table below

    Standard resistance 

    RESISTANCE REFERENCE

    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ition
    S62-9 (LIN) - X6-2 (LIN) Always Below 1 Ω
    S62-9 (LIN) or X6-2 (LIN)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her

    Standard voltage 

    VOLTAGE SPECIFICATION

    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ition
    S62-9 (LIN) or X6-2 (LIN) - Body ground Always Below 1 V

    NG: REPAIR OR REPLACE HARNESS OR CONNECTOR 

    OK: Go to next step 

  2. C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(MAP LIGHT - BATTERY AND BODY GROUND) 
    1. Disconnect the X4 Map light connector.
    2. Measure the resistance and voltage according to the value(s) in the table below.

    Standard resistance 

    RESISTANCE REFERENCE

    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ition
    X4-16 (GND9) - Body ground Always Below 1 Ω

    Standard voltage 

    VOLTAGE SPECIFICATION

    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ition
    X4-6 (+B) - Body ground Always 11 to 14 V

    NG: REPAIR OR REPLACE HARNESS OR CONNECTOR 

    Fig 2: Identifying Map Light X4 Connector Terminals
    G04946989Courtesy of © TOYOTA, LICENSE AGREEMENT TMS1002

    OK: Go to next step 

  3. CHECK MAP LIGHT ASSEMBLY (OPERATION) 
    1. Temporarily replace the map light assembly with a new or normally functioning one (see REMOVAL )
    2. Clear the DTC (see DTC CHECK / CLEAR )
  4. CHECK FOR DTC 
    1. Recheck for DTC (see DTC CHECK / CLEAR )

    Result: 

    RESULT REFERENCE

    Result Proceed to
    DTC B2405 output does not reoccur A
    DTC B2405 output reoccurs B

    B: REPLACE LUGGAGE ROOM JUNCTION BLOCK (REAR JUNCTION BLOCK ECU) 

    A: END (MAP LIGHT ASSEMBLY IS DEFECTIVE)
